It allows you to load png images of all sizes and position them the way you want with your mouse. Choose from over a million free vectors, clipart graphics, vector art images, design templates, and illustrations created by artists worldwide. The sections can be static graphics or frames of animation. In computer graphics, a sprite sheet is defined as a bitmap image file made up of numerous smaller graphics that are integrated into a tiled grid formation. Click on the sprite editor button in the texture import inspector fig 2. Using a nodegroup to manipate uv coordinates, spritehandler sequences sprite sheets loaded through image texture nodes. Note that you cant edit a sprite which is in the scene view. Take a look at sprite sheet cgtrader 3d designer profile, portfolio and 3d models available. I personally love crafting my own sprite sheets by hand, i feel my 2d animations much more under control, but for this article im using a finished sprite sheet. All functionality is wrapped in intuitive operators for efficiency. Aug 02, 2016 the different sprite sheets would also be loaded dynamically for type of outfit sword jetpack so for outfit naked id have a sprite sheet of all the naked stances, for shirt id simply change which sprite sheet im using on outfit to the shirt sprite sheet.
The sprite editor is used to slice individual sprites from an atlas or sprite sheet. Spritehandler is a set of tools for using, and generating, sprite sheets within blender. The qt quick sprite engine is a stochastic state machine combined with the. I created this software while developing my own game which uses sprite stacks and found myself disappointed with the tools available to me. You can get visibility into the health and performance of your cisco asa environment in a single dashboard. Youll use the patch editor to make the confetti start in response an open mouth, and stop when the mouth is closed.
Just a little time saver, instead of using the lasso tool to select the. A spritesheet is like a library of all the art for the game, and the game cuts and pastes sections from the spritesheet to create the graphics at runtime. In this tutorial ill show you how to make sprite sheets in ps and then how to import those into unity to make 2d game ready animations. Nov 10, 2014 i personally love crafting my own sprite sheets by hand, i feel my 2d animations much more under control, but for this article im using a finished sprite sheet. Unity provides a sprite packer utility to automate the process of generating atlases from the individual sprite textures. It also features tools to generate custom animation sequences for your spritesheet. And if you dont see this,simply right click at the top of your menu hereand come down and select game. Learn how to use a sprite sheet to enable animate and other applications to. This opens up a wealth of possibities for rendering sprites, flipbooks, billboards, particles, and material variations.
To run this software, you need a web browser as it is a webbased software. I think its more efficient to have the graphics card do the heavy lifting, that being said. Need to write or generate a long stylesheet with a class for each image. Dungeon crafter is a small freeware program that lets you lay down walls, floors, doors, and objects. I can render a whole image just fine, but now im actually trying to write my own shader. Before adding it to unity, check if the size of your sprite sheet is. Autosuggest helps you quickly narrow down your search results by suggesting possible matches as you type. Sprite sheets only have one redeeming quality, they are a little faster to load. You can only see the sprite editor button if the texture type on the image you have selected is set to sprite 2d and ui. The animation player allows you to set type of sheet, rows, columns, canvas size, frame numbers and speed. See importing and setting up sprites below for information on setting up assets as sprites in your unity project. I use the term sprite sheet as a synonym for texture atlas. This process will include importing and slicing a sprite sheet ken from street fighter, assigning animation states with the new animation controller, and scripting simple keyboard controls to change.
With the difference that on a sprite sheets, objects are placed beside each other on a very wide canvas. I do not know if a class is the best way to do it, but i have tried my best. What im trying to do is render a sprite from a sprite sheet. Sprite sheets already exist since the first days of computer games. Permission is hereby granted, free of charge, to any person obtaining a copy of this software and associated documentation files the software, to deal in the software without restriction, including without limitation the rights to. We strive for 100% accuracy and only publish information about file formats that we have tested and validated. Sprite animation is created by the same tool using hinged 2dbones models and.
Thats where the real power of these type of applications are for such a task. About this software inspired by similar software and pixel art tools, spritepile is an attempt at creating the very best tool to create. Unity phaser cocos2dx libgdx corona sdk css html pixijs. It has a fairly good and easy to use sprite editor and you can also export the sprite sheet. Cyotek spriter is a free application for creating sprite sheets and individual sprite graphics. Enter tile size or the number of columns and rows, and this tool will slice the image for you, outputting images in png, gif or jpg format. Now the first section is the select directory,so were going to saywhere we want to save out these sprite sheets. This opens up a wealth of possiblities for rendering sprites, flipbooks, billboards, particles, and material variations. Sprite sheet studio pixelink software a division of. This tutorial shows what sprite sheet types exist and how you can easily create a sprite sheet yourself.
The ability to rip frames from sprite type objects in an swf file i have an swf file whos graphics are mainly stored in frames of sprite type objects, and not stored in raw frame type objects. The best windows software for sprite sheets are appgamekit studio, geexlab, fast video to gif swf converter, libgdx and waveengine. For a full class on how to use different types of sprite sheets in kwik. Loadall sprite returns an array instead of a dictionary.
I wanted a way to quickly slice up spritesheet rips for a game i am working on. This type displays sprite animations with the same input format, but only one at a time. Leshy spritesheet tool can be used to perform a large number of different sprite sheet related tasks. Sheetah turns your after effects composition into a single spritesheet file blazingly fast. Texturepacker preserves the directory structure under the directory you added allowing you to group and sort sprites. Lets learn together what spritesheets are and how they can be used. You can then use this in an html5 animation, as shown in a previous episode. Texturepacker is a tool that specializes in creating sprite sheets. Figure 1 shows an example of a type of spritesheet commonly called a chipset. To create a sprite sheet in photoshop, you need to perfectly place each picture on a new layer in, which can take some time. Learn how to assemble and style a series of frames in the png format, exported from after effects, into a single sprite sheet graphic using sketch. By compiling several graphics into a single file, you enable animate and.
Loop a section in forward, reverse, pingpong modes. In this tutorial i will be explaining how to manage 2d animation states for characters in unity3d using the new 2d tools that shipped with version 4. So you have to iterate over the sprite and compare the sprite names to find a specific. Oct 15, 2018 permission is hereby granted, free of charge, to any person obtaining a copy of this software and associated documentation files the software, to deal in the software without restriction, including without limitation the rights to use, copy, modify, merge, publish, distribute, sublicense, andor sell copies of the software, and to permit. However, at this time of writing there is no builtin way to export the sprites as individual images. Plus, it is also portable and you can use it on the go without actually installing it. Sprite sheets arent the only way to play 2d animations an your effects. Feb 19, 2019 python pygame extension that provides spritesheet class. Sprite sheet creator adobe support community 10061600. Create a new sprite, create a new folder called sprites and drag athe spritesheet into it select the sprite in the hierarchy tab and configure their values trough the inspector tab. Why use a sprite sheet rather than individual images. Use spriter to create a single sprite sheet from multiple image sources, generate appropriate css classes via an easy to use template system. Photoshop and illustrator sprite sheet creator advena.
In my resources folder structure i have myself a file, now in the unity editor this file is a texture type sprite 2d and ui, now when i attempt to run this code in one of my scripts var icons. If some wants to know more about how sprite sheets are made, give a look to this post from the good old times. Using sprite sheet animations in cocos2dx v3 learn how to use sprite sheets and animations in cocos2dx, design for different devices and screen sizes and optimize your game. In a nutshell, a sprite sheet is a way of packing images together as one image, which is then used to create animations and sprite graphics as it will use low memory and increase the performance of games. There are a number of options including a json export for scripting but it should be helpful to pull animations together or to build any kind of. Cyotek spriter create sprite sheets and dynamic text.
In todays update, three main games really got the bulk on attention. Okay, now im going to click and selectthe button that says export to sprite sheets. Then create a new folder under the asset folder called sprites and drag a sprite sheet into it. Unitys builtin spritesheet editor has some fantastic tools to slice spritesheets automatically. This combination of several graphics into one file allows you to utilize them in anime and various other applications by simply loading a single file. Tips and tools for creating spritesheet animations game. If you have existing sprite graphics, apply post process effects such as rotation, resizing or recolouring without touching the original image.
The different sprite sheets would also be loaded dynamically for type of outfit sword jetpack so for outfit naked id have a sprite sheet of all the naked stances, for shirt id simply change which sprite sheet im using on outfit to the shirt sprite sheet. Great tool but its missing a few things that id like to see definitely put in the next version of the software. Sprite sheet free vector art 54 free downloads vecteezy. Need to load a large image to just display even one small image. If youre not sure which to choose, learn more about installing packages. It is only available for windows at present but ifis a free sprite sheet sliceranimator. In this tutorial ill show you how to make sprite sheets in ps and then how to. Spriter 2 is being built from the ground up to offer a new level of flexibility and ease of use for 2d game animation. In computer graphics, a sprite sheet is defined as a bitmap image file made up of numerous smaller graphics that. Python pygame extension that provides spritesheet class. Take a look at spritesheet cgtrader 3d designer profile, portfolio and 3d models available. A sprite sheet is a bitmap image file that contains several smaller graphics in a tiled grid arrangement. Right now the tool only works with this one specific type of sprite sheet layout. Paranoia character sheet is the next free open source character sheet generator software for windows, linux, and macos.
Spritesheet animation in adobe flash intel software. Watch this video in context on unitys learning pages here. All file types, file format descriptions, and software programs listed on this page have been individually researched and verified by the fileinfo team. This tool will create a sprite sheet based on your edited layers in a click. In another episode, youll create the same graphic using photoshop. Texture publishing is applicable only to html5 canvas document type. Check out best 3d models from top modeling artists in 3d industry.
Texture packer is hands down the best sprite sheet generation tool on the. Create a sprite sheet or texture atlas and export your animations for mobile apps and game engines. Sprite sheets software free download sprite sheets top. The animation player allows you to set type of sheet, rows.
Basic java game library bjgl is a java game library what provides quick and easy assistance while building a 2d game. When a sprite animation finishes, the sprite engine will choose the next sprite. Texture import inspector and the sprite editor displays fig 3. Our goal is to help you understand what a file with a. Ive built a free web based sprite generation tool which might be helpful for some users that need to pull together individual 2d images into an optimized power of 2 sprite downloadable texture. Learn how to create a nicely packed sprite sheet and corresponding json data file. Using a node group to manipulate uv coordinates, spritehandler sequences sprite sheets loaded through image texture nodes. Oct 04, 2011 a spritesheet is like a library of all the art for the game, and the game cuts and pastes sections from the spritesheet to create the graphics at runtime. Integrate aseprite in your assets pipeline with the commandline interface cli.
New sprites in the directory are added to the sheet as soon as you. It will be built around advanced image deforming, bone and curve manipulation, and lots of other completely new features to help game creators make the most impressive visuals as easily as possible. Export animations for mobile apps and game engines adobe support. Animate enables you to create sprite sheet or texture atlas animations and export them for mobile apps and game engines. Free online tool for cutting image sprites to individual images. Theres plenty of room for improvement to add more features to the tool for sprite sheets that are packed differently, or even add a texture packer to the tool itself. The sprite editor unity official tutorials youtube. Sprite sheets software free download sprite sheets top 4. They present a massive step backwards in design technology, which probably explains why the only people who like using sprite sheets are old school game developers. First of all, the xna framework works on my computer, but i do not wish to use it for reasons.